Open-source multilingual ASR reaches 28 European languages via Whisper and LLM fusion
MEUSLI represents a meaningful step toward democratizing multilingual speech AI by combining Whisper's acoustic encoding with open-source LLMs to enable end-to-end ASR across 28 European languages. The system's ability to extend to unseen languages through continual learning addresses a persistent gap in speech model coverage, where most production systems remain English-centric or support only a handful of high-resource languages. This work signals growing momentum in the open-science speech community to move beyond monolingual bottlenecks, directly competing with proprietary cloud ASR APIs and expanding the practical scope of edge-deployable speech systems.

ExplainerMEUSLI's actual novelty is narrower than the summary suggests: it's a projection layer that bridges two existing systems (Whisper's acoustic encoder and open LLMs) rather than a new architecture. The continual learning claim for unseen languages remains unvalidated on languages outside the 28 tested.

If MEUSLI's continual learning mechanism successfully adapts to a language family outside Indo-European (e.g., Sino-Tibetan or Afro-Asiatic) with fewer than 100 hours of labeled audio, that confirms the generalization claim. If it requires retraining on each new language, the 'beyond 28' framing collapses and it becomes a clever engineering contribution rather than a methodological advance.
